State Fair




If you haven't heard, the State Fair has changed locations. It is now at the Verizon (Oak Mountain) Amphitheatre. We took the kids last night and had an absolute blast. This new location is so much better. Greg and I haven't been to the fair in years, this was so much fun. I do have to say it was expensive! I don't see how big families afford it. You had to pay to park, pay to get in and then even for the kiddie rides it was $4 per ride. We ended up getting the kids armbands which was definetely the best way to go. The kids weren't tall enouugh to ride all of the kiddie rides. Next year will be so much fun! We did all ride the farris wheel. It was a great family moment. Enjoy the pictures.
